Fig. 1From: Diverse biological processes coordinate the transcriptional response to nutritional changes in a Drosophila melanogaster multiparent populationStudy design. Flies drawn from 835 RILs of the DSPR were bred together for 5 generations to create an outbred panel. Eggs were collected from this homogenous population and resulting flies reared on dietary restriction (DR), control (C) and high sugar (HS) diets in six replicates for 10 days from day 12 post-oviposition. Heads, ovaries and bodies were dissected over 100 female flies from each treatment replicate for total mRNA extractionBack to article page
